STATEMENT BY:
MR HENNIE BEKKER MP
IFP SPOKESPERSON ON ECONOMIC AFFAIRS
11th April 2008
The Inkatha
Freedom Party would like to express its disappointment with the
latest increase in the repo rate.
It is a
major blow to households and the SA economy, under siege by
external factors.
We agree
that stability and predictability is needed in the SA economy,
and whilst the IFP believes in inflation targeting, the current
3-6% band is not appropriate if the current unstable economic
environment is taken into consideration.
The IFP
believes that today's increase will cause further undue hardship
on cash-strapped South Africans, particularly in the lower and
middle income groups.
Government
must stop punishing struggling South Africans and rather
consider adjusting the inflation band upwards.
